Dogs - Ukraine

Mass killing of dogs - the first process in Ukraine

15 February 2012 - After mass killing of street dogs in Ukraine for the first time two so-called Doghunter stand trial.

A 19-year-old should have at least 30 stray dogs poisoned and stabbed to death, as the newspaper "segodnja" reported on Tuesday in Kiev. Animal rights activists even go out of about 100 bloody deeds. The co-defendants had filmed the murders and put the clips on the Internet - this flew on the duo. The men could face up to five years in prison

To start of the trial had a large police presence to protect defendants applied animal friends. The main defendant had previously been severely threatened. "I fear for my life," said the young man.

The Ukraine is one of the countries hosting the soccer Euro 2012. Because of the dogs killing the ex-Soviet republic had fallen before the European Championships in critics. Animal rights activists accused the authorities to be killed en masse in the four venues of street dogs. Now to the strays to be sterilized with German assistance.

Ukraine, January 2011. For the stray dogs Kharkiv (Kharkov) residents built a hut, where animals can hide from the cold.

Many dogs and cats are poisoned by various toxic substances - usually rat poison or pesticide. Food is prepared with the poison and put out where the abandoned companion animals and the stray animals are - in villages and towns. Many local residents say that they have been invited to give poisoned food to the dogs and cats - they are also worried about their own animals and that children accidentally ingest the poison which is also have been found in playgrounds. The animals are usually starving and will eat what they find - they suffer very badly from the poison, they get cramps and pain and the process can take an hour before they die. To poison animals in the EU and Europe is unfortunately a common way for governments and citizens to get rid of unwanted abandoned animals - governments should instead take their responsibility and institute laws to be followed in order to prevent unwanted animals are born and become abandoned.

(2011) Yard cleaners throw the corpses to garbage bins because there is no other way to utilize them. These garbage bins are near the houses where people live and near the playground where children play. There is the smell of decaying body. It brakes sanitary code. Animal Help League volunteers called for police and at the moment they are drawing up a report - We don't have shelters, neither neutering program. We have only poisonings.
